Comprehending Link Building: The Basics and Its Significance
Link building serves as a cornerstone of powerful SEO strategies, substantially influencing a website's prominence and credibility. It encompasses acquiring hyperlinks from external sites to one's own, creating pathways for users and search engines to navigate the web. These links act as endorsements, signaling credibility and relevance to search engines like Google. The quantity and quality of links can substantially affect a site's ranking on search engine results pages (SERPs), making link building a crucial aspect of digital marketing.
Well-executed link building improves a website's authority and fosters partnerships within its niche. It also generates referral traffic, as users who click on these backlinks are often genuinely interested in the content. Understanding link building is critical for businesses striving to improve their online presence, as it not only boosts visibility but also helps build a more strong online reputation. In the end, link building is vital for long-term SEO success and overall business growth.

On-Page Search Optimization Strategies
On-page optimization techniques serve a crucial function in improving a website's visibility and search engine rankings. These approaches incorporate various factors, including keyword optimization, meta tags, and content quality. Properly integrating relevant keywords into headings and body text guarantees that search engines can accurately index the content. Additionally, crafting compelling meta titles and descriptions can greatly improve click-through rates from search engine results pages. It is similarly vital to maintain a clear and logical site structure, facilitating easy navigation for both users and search engines. Enhancing images with descriptive alt tags and ensuring mobile responsiveness are also critical elements. Finally, effective on-page optimization creates a user-friendly experience while signaling relevance to search engines, thereby increasing overall ranking performance.
Quality Backlink Acquisition
While various factors determine a website's search engine ranking, quality backlink acquisition remains one of the most critical elements. Search engines, particularly Google, prioritize sites with backlinks from reputable and relevant sources as indicators of reliability and authority. A strategic approach to building backlinks involves creating high-quality content that naturally attracts links, engaging in guest blogging, and fostering relationships with industry influencers. Additionally, businesses can benefit from leveraging social media platforms to share content and increase visibility. Monitoring competitor backlink profiles and using tools like Ahrefs or SEMrush can also provide information into potential link-building opportunities. Ultimately, focusing on the quality and relevance of backlinks, rather than sheer quantity, plays a major role in improved search engine rankings.

How to Gauge Link Building Success?
Which indicators help organizations evaluate their link building performance? Various significant benchmarks can supply meaningful feedback. Initially, recording the quantity of earned backlinks across time can reveal development and engagement effectiveness. Moreover, tracking the domain strength of link sources assists in measuring connection value. Fluctuations in unpaid traffic can equally demonstrate the effect of link building on comprehensive online visibility.
Another important metric is referral traffic, which reveals how many visitors come from linked sources. Businesses should also evaluate keyword rankings, as better positions in search additional article results can reflect successful link acquisition. Moreover, conversion rates from referral traffic can reveal the effectiveness of links in driving sales or leads. By examining these metrics collectively, businesses can achieve a complete understanding of their link building success and make informed adjustments to their strategies as appropriate.
Common Mistakes in Link Building to Avoid
Although link building is essential for boosting a website's SEO, countless businesses fall into common pitfalls that can sabotage their efforts. One significant mistake is focusing on quantity over quality; acquiring multiple low-quality links can harm a site's reputation. Another error is overlooking relevance; links from unrelated sites add little value and may even prompt penalties from search engines. Moreover, some businesses neglect to monitor their backlink profiles, causing unrecognized toxic links that could damage their rankings. Furthermore, counting solely on automated link-building tools can produce unnatural link patterns, which search engines can easily recognize. Finally, overlooking relationship building is harmful; building genuine connections with industry influencers often generates higher-quality backlinks. By avoiding these mistakes, businesses can establish a more effective link-building strategy that enhances their SEO performance.

What Types of Links Should I Avoid?
It's essential to avoid spammy, low-quality links, compensated links from dubious sources, and links from unrelated or irrelevant websites. Furthermore, reciprocal link schemes and excessive manipulation of anchor text can also damage visibility and credibility.
